According to lead programmer Tim Closs in a 2015 interview with the franchise fansite Highway Frogs, Frogger was supposed to be an open-world 3D game (in a similar vein to Super Mario 64, which released a year prior). Internal disagreements caused them to change it to operate like the original Frogger game, but in a top-down 3D style.
The expansive maps, outside of the Retro Zone stages, may be a remnant of this original idea.
